2060314 FARRAGUT PARTNERS LLP 74fdc2d0-cdfd-4cc2-93cf-9d2677a40fc7 Q4 FARRAGUT PARTNERS LLP 401103938 BLUE CROSS BLUE SHIELD ASSOCIATION 2017 fourth_quarter MMM Medicare/Medicaid Issues: Chronic care improvement ideas; Medicare A & B; Delivery System Reforms; Benefit Restructuring ; Medigap; Medicare Advantage Risk Delay; Community Health Management; Medicare fraud; Cybersecurity; ICD10; Medicare Prescription Drug Integrity; Provider directories HR 6 21st Century Cures Act Introduced May 19, 2015 by Fred Upton (RMI) This bill amends the Public Health Service Act to reauthorize the National Institutes of Health (NIH) through FY2018. The NIH Innovation Fund is established to fund a strategic plan, early stage investigators, and highrisk, highreward research. The NIH may require scientific data to be shared if the research is fully funded by the NIH. The NIH and the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) must implement a system that allows further research on clinical trial data.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ention must expand surveillance of neurological diseases. The Council for 21st Century Cures is established to accelerate the discovery, development, and delivery of innovative cures, treatments, and preventive measures. The Department of Health and Human Services must monitor the use of antibacterial and antifungal drugs and resistance to these drugs. HR 928 Introduced February 12, 2015 by Charles Boustany (RLA) To repeal the annual fee on health insurance providers enacted by the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act.
